GENEVA — The markets have read the calendar. With the Global Concordat Council due to open an emergency session on water allocation next week, traders on the Cerulean Exchange spent Wednesday repositioning around a decision that has not yet been made. Contracts tied to desalination capacity and drought-relief logistics moved on rumor and reservoir data alone, as three continents report falling storage and ministers are summoned toward the still-upcoming talks. "You are not trading the outcome; you are trading how frightened everyone is of the outcome," said commodities analyst Priyanka Roy, who tracks water-linked instruments for a mid-sized Geneva fund. Roy cautions clients against mistaking the session's approach for its result: nothing has been allocated, nothing decided. But the price of that uncertainty is real, and it lands hardest, she notes, on the water-stressed megacities least able to hedge — where a spread on a screen in Geneva becomes a tariff on a tap in a place with no futures desk at all.
